Obsidian (Lux #1) by Jennifer L. Armentrout
My Thoughts: Did you like the Twilight books? Are you still liking them? I did (and I'm not ashamed to admit it), and I also enjoyed Obsidian.
Daemon would be really mad, if I compare him to a certain sparkling vampire. Because first, he's not a vampire, but an alien. And second, he's anything, but sweet and sparkly. He's more prickly than sparkly. As he's kind of a prick. A very fine looking prick. *points to the cover*
Beautiful face. Beautiful body. Horrible attitude. It was the holy trinity of hot boys.
But we all know, brooding/moody bad guys are hot, and he even had his reasons.
Okay, let's ingore Daemon's wounded pride, and admit that those two books have a lot in common. But as I have said above I liked Twilight, and I liked this one as well. I, in general, like books about romance between different species, and this one has many great characters, both human and alien.
I've heard many yummy things about Daemon before reading Obsidian, and he was exactly how I expected him to be, a gorgeous dick. :P
Katy was funny, and I'm totally approving her hobbies (book blogging!). I have never before read about a heroine, who was also a book blogger. I loved this little detail.
And Daemon's little sister, Dee is such a bubble a sunshine. You couldn't help, but like her. I totally understood why Katy wanted to be her friend.
The title and cover were both great choices. I love the greenish tone of the cover (oh, those eyes!) and you can't go wrong with gemstone names. We girls love our jewelry. :)
The good writing and the fast moving plot made Obsidian absolutely entertaining. I love reading about aliens, and Daemon's kind is truly fascinating. I can't wait to learn more about them in the next book(s). There was no cliffhanger in the end. But it's also not HEA, so it's a good thing that the next book, Onyx is almost out, as I can't wait to devour it.
Title: Obsidian
Series: Lux #1
Author: Jennifer L. Armentrout
Blurb from Goodreads:
Starting over sucks. When we moved to West Virginia right before my senior year, I'd pretty much resigned myself to thick accents, dodgy internet access, and a whole lot of boring.... until I spotted my hot neighbor, with his looming height and eerie green eyes. Things were looking up. And then he opened his mouth.
Daemon is infuriating. Arrogant. Stab-worthy. We do not get along. At all. But when a stranger attacks me and Daemon literally freezes time with a wave of his hand, well, something...unexpected happens. The hot alien living next door marks me. You heard me. Alien. Turns out Daemon and his sister have a galaxy of enemies wanting to steal their abilities, and Daemon's touch has me lit up like the Vegas Strip. The only way I'm getting out of this alive is by sticking close to Daemon until my alien mojo fades. If I don't kill him first, that is.
Published:
May 8th 2012 by Entangled Teen
